If you are intimidated by the thought of rolling your own pie dough or baking a cake from scratch, you probably run to your local bakery or grocery-store freezer for dessert rather than make your own. Baking - even for proficient home cooks - can be scary but there is a delicious satisfaction in presenting family and friends with fresh-out-of-the-oven desserts and breakfast breads that you have made yourself.
In THE FEARLESS BAKER, renowned pastry chef Emily Luchetti offers 175 delectable and easy-to-follow recipes along with straightforward, lasting advice specifically geared toward beginners. Luchetti and co-author Lisa Weiss arranged kitchen sessions with a group of novice bakers, ordinary folks who enjoy cooking but have always felt nervous about the precise measuring, rolling, folding and mixing that many baking projects require.

Emily Luchetti has developed a nationwide following for her innovative yet approachable dessert creations. She is executive pastry chef at Farallon and Waterbar in the San Francisco Bay Area. Lisa Weiss is a food writer and stylist whose work has appeared in such publications as Cook's Illustrated and Cooking Light.
